No auction of DDA's MIG/HIG flats, back to 'lottery' system

New Delhi, June 30 (UNI) In view of pressure from elected representatives in the national capital, Union Urban Development Ministry Jaipal Reddy today decided to cancel the move to auction Delhi Development Authority Middle and Higher Income Group flats in the city and revert to the lottery mode.

Delhi Lieutenant Governor B L Joshi, who is also DDA Chairperson, telephoned me on June 28 and conveyed to me the sentiments of the elected members of authority against the proposal to auction MIG and HIG DDA flats, he said in a statement.

At the request of the LG, I received two elected members of DDA yesterday who also pleaded against the auction mode, he added.

''In view of the strong sentiments of the elected members of DDA, it is appropriate to revert to the lottery mode,'' Mr Reddy said.

DDA was being informed accordingly, the mininster added.

Yesterday, Congress MLA Mahabal Mishra and Municipal Councillor Virender Kasana had handed over a representation to Mr Reddy opposing the ministry's decision to auction the flats.

The two, who were also elected DDA members, met the minister at his office here, to hand over the representation.

In their representation, the two state Congress leaders said the decision was anti-people and it should be withdrawn immediately.

The representation was being considered, the minister had said.

Earlier, BJP MLA Mange Ram Garg, also a DDA member, had opposed the decision and demanded the Prime Minister's intervention.

This decision should not be implemented and the flats should be alloted to to people who had booked for these by making payment, he added.

The representation had come after all four non-official DDA members - Mr Mishra, Mr Kasana, Mr Garg and another Congress Jile Singh Chauhan - had walked out of a meeting at DDA on June 28 opposing the decision to auction flats instead of allotment through draw of lots, saying the decision had been taken 'bypassing' the DDA and the Delhi Lt Governor.

Later, the four met the LG and urged him to speak to Mr Reddy on the issue.
